6
|
A student must pass CIV4000 Individual Research Project at the first attempt in order to be eligible for the award of the Degree of MEng in Civil and Structural Engineering with Study Abroad Year (CIVU29). A student who fails to satisfy this requirement may be permitted by the Faculty to be awarded the Degree of BEng in Civil Engineering (CIVU17) but will be ineligible for the award of that Degree with Honours.
